Transaction f21452be93689e51a5e532970296fb534a9ca6aec2e5890df0de7aabd53ef77c
1 Input
1 Output
-
f21452be93689e51a5e532970296fb534a9ca6aec2e5890df0de7aabd53ef77c:0
- value
- 75224315
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0654a13d4d81dbd046ab0d56bd0763d71c49f2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1aUSLTWhhfDH319qJwbvuSmdKvmj66SJv